diff --git a/sys-kernel/dracut/files/034-0011-lvm-fix-thin-recognition.patch b/sys-kernel/dracut/files/034-0011-lvm-fix-thin-recognition.patch
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..b2dfc777814c
--- /dev/null
+++ b/sys-kernel/dracut/files/034-0011-lvm-fix-thin-recognition.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,40 @@
+From a70dff7f103b27d5b7016e13a64c7710c61dc96e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Harald Hoyer <harald@redhat.com>
+Date: Wed, 16 Oct 2013 11:30:08 +0200
+Subject: [PATCH 11/12] lvm: fix thin recognition
+
+The global var setting was happening in a pipe and did not have an
+effect.
+
+Use <<<$() instead.
+
+< <() cannot be used, because dracut is called in chroot's environments,
+where /dev/fd does not point to /proc/self/fd, but bash wants
+/dev/fd/<num> for this construct.
+---
+ modules.d/90lvm/module-setup.sh | 5 +++--
+ 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+
+diff --git a/modules.d/90lvm/module-setup.sh b/modules.d/90lvm/module-setup.sh
+index f8b598d..cbdf4a2 100755
+--- a/modules.d/90lvm/module-setup.sh
++++ b/modules.d/90lvm/module-setup.sh
+@@ -57,12 +57,13 @@ install() {
+ inst lvm
+
+ if [[ $hostonly ]]; then
+- get_host_lvs | while read line; do
++ while read line; do
++ [[ -n "$line" ]] || continue
+ printf "%s" " rd.lvm.lv=$line"
+ if ! [[ $_needthin ]]; then
+ [[ "$(lvs --noheadings -o segtype ${line%%/*} 2>/dev/null)" == *thin* ]] && _needthin=1
+ fi
+- done >> "${initdir}/etc/cmdline.d/90lvm.conf"
++ done <<<$(get_host_lvs) >> "${initdir}/etc/cmdline.d/90lvm.conf"
+ echo >> "${initdir}/etc/cmdline.d/90lvm.conf"
+ else
+ _needthin=1
+--
+1.8.4.3
+
